2020年长江洪水监测预报预警

程海云

摘要: 2020年长江发生了流域性大洪水,得益于水文监测、预报预警技术体系的创新发展,长江水利委员会(简称“长江委”)水文局扎实开展汛前技术准备,科学实施水文测报预警,有效支撑了长江流域防汛工作。重点介绍了长江水文测验管理服务体系、技术支撑体系及质量控制体系等长江水文监测创新技术,还介绍了不同时间尺度的水文气象无缝耦合渐进式预报分析技术及预报调度一体化技术。并结合2020年流域性大洪水实践,分析总结了水文测验、水文预报、预警发布在长江流域防汛工作中所取得的成效及不足,展望了未来的发展方向和研究重点,以期进一步提升长江水文监测预报预警能力。

关键词: 水文监测; 洪水预报; 洪水预警; 2020年长江洪水;

Abstract: In 2020, a basin-wide flood occurred in the Yangtze River. Benefiting from the innovation and development in hydrological monitoring, forecasting and warning technology system, Bureau of Hydrology(BOH), Changjiang Water Resources Commission made solid technical preparations before flood season and scientifically implemented hydrological forecasting and early warning during flood season, which effectively supported the flood control work. This paper mainly introduces hydrological monitoring innovation technology, such as management service system, technical support system and quality control system of hydrometry, as well as the hydrological and meteorological seamless coupling progressive forecast analysis technology, forecast and operation integration technology. Combined with the monitoring and forecasting and early warning practice in Changjiang River Flood in 2020, achievements and deficiencies in the flood control work were summarized and analyzed. The future development direction and research focus were then proposed in order to improve the ability of hydrological monitoring, forecasting and early warning of the Yangtze River.

Key words: hydrological monitoring; flood forecast; flood warning; Changjiang River flood in 2020;
